    French and Prussians for the german war of liberation 1813-1814

    Hi,

    Some of you might have seen me and my cousins blog http://ploughsharestoswords.blogspot.se/. I feel it would be interesting to do a project log also so I and Anders the younger can get some direct feedback from the Warseer community considering our painting efforts.

    What we are working on right now:

    I'm currently working on a french Line battalion carrying an eagle 34 models strong, 10 done so far and 2 bases of skirmishers. After they are done I will focus on cavalry for a while

    Anders the younger is currently painting his second Prussian grenadier battalion and after that he will start on a second Landwehr battalion and continue with his hussars.

    The Plan:

    Without going into specifics (see the blog for that), I will have 8 infantry battalions and 4 cavalry squadrons. Of those 5 battalions are done so far and so are 2 squadrons.

    Anders the younger is going to have 9 infantry battalions and 4 smaller cavalry squadrons. He is done with 2 infantry battalions and has started on the cavalry.

    Hi and thank you,

    I think it should be the pictures because I use quite a lot of washes on my metallics.

    Rules are going to be Republic to empire from League of augsburg we are planning to put up a post on the blog about the system in the future.

    On the painting table now are two more line battalions in Bardin regulation uniforms, One Eagle battalion and one regular battalion. So far I'm done with the 2 command bases and 1 grenadier bases while 12 line infantry are in the wip stage.

    Anders the younger are currently working on a west Prussian grenadier battalion, he is done with the command bases and have 24 of in wip.

    After the line infantry I will probably add a squadron to the Dragoon and Curassier units. Anders the younger will problay start with either a landwehr battalion or a line battalion.
